Chlorine sensor

I am looking for a sensor that can meaure the chlorine content of water ?
 

Re: Chlorine sensor

First you must distinguish what to measure:

Cl2 (gas disoved in water)

or Cl- (chlorine anion disolved in water)


There are spectrometric methods to measure them precisely.

I don't know any Electro-chemestry methods to measure them with simple electronics.
